The Southern Cross of Honor was conceived of in 1898, adopted in 1899 and first issued in 1900. These were given by the United Daughters of the Confederacy to living Confederate veterans with honorable service in the Confederate army, navy or marines. More than 78,000 were presented between 1900 and 1913, and an unknown number afterward.
The medal itself is a bronze toned Maltese Cross. The obverse bears a Confederate Battle Flag surrounded by a laurel wreath and the words "United Daughters [of the] Confederacy to the UCV” on the branches of the cross. The reverse has a wreath of laurel surrounding the words "Deo / Vindice / 1861 / 1865" and the inscription, "Southern Cross of Honor" on the four branches of the cross.
The medal is attached to a tan colored ribbon with attachment pin present on the reverse. [ld][ph:L]
